• Contract Opportunity: Accounts Receivable & Finance Specialist (6-Month Term)
Contract Length: 6 Months
Are you ready to make a measurable impact in just six months? Join a fast-paced, collaborative finance team where your skills in accounting, collections, and customer service will directly contribute to reducing outstanding receivables and improving financial operations.
• What You’ll Do
+ Take ownership of accounts receivable processes, proactively resolving discrepancies and reducing aged accounts—your work will matter from day one.
+ Collaborate cross-functionally with internal teams and external clients to implement tailored payment solutions.
+ Analyze complex financial data to identify trends and resolve issues with precision.
+ Serve as a trusted consultant to customers, resolving complaints with professionalism and empathy.
• What You Bring
+ A solid foundation in finance and credit concepts, with a basic understanding of commercial/consumer law.
+ Strong analytical and problem-solving skills—you love digging into data to find solutions.
+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to work with diverse teams and clients.
+ Detail-oriented, self-motivated, and organized—you thrive in a deadline-driven environment.
+ Experience with ERP systems like SAP or Oracle is a plus.
+ Proficiency in Microsoft Excel (V-lookups, aging reports, etc.).
• Technical Skills
+ Accounting, Accounts Receivable, Cash Application, Collections
+ ERP Systems (SAP, Oracle), Microsoft Office Suite
+ Reporting & Analysis (Aging Reports, V-Lookups)
